We held our wedding at Askham Hall this weekend just gone (28/10/17), and phenomenal doesn't even come close to covering it - everything was sheer perfection. Anybody considering it as a venue, just book it now, before somebody beats you to it.

The venue itself is breathtakingly beautiful, each bedroom unique, stunning tiled floors, grounds that look perfect in any season. The Bank Barn requires almost no decoration, the Medieval Barn is the perfect setting for an intimate ceremony and the lounge and study are cosy and comfortable.

The food was wonderful - the team went out of their way to accommodate bespoke choices for us and executed everything to perfection. Evening pizzas were well-timed and delicious.

What made everything so amazing, though, was undeniably the team. Vicki, the wedding coordinator, was everywhere at once, making sure that everything went perfectly for us, nothing too much trouble. Nico, house manager and sommelier, ran everything seamlessly, and was utterly charming.

Our guests were full of complements for Askham Hall - the decor, the food, the staff, and almost everybody asked how we had found such a wonderful place. The truth is, we stumbled upon it, and we're so, so glad that we did.

Thank you, thank you, thank you for the best day of our lives ��

Clare & Phil

I got a reasonable deal but was disappointed by the contrast between the grandness of the main building and the quality of my room.

The room was tired, the bathroom very old and the bed mediocre at best. The TV was from another century and to top it off Tetley tea as I recall. You'd expect Twinnings at the very least!

I was only in the barn room used for weddings & parties etc. Bar situated at one end up some steps. Really large room, brilliant for weddings, christenings & parties. The fairy lights hanging from the ceiling made it look really magical. The surroundings outside were well kept, clean & tidy and there was ample parking.

Lovely. Like one of those places that I considered not reviewing because I don't want other people to know about it lovely. I came here just before my birthday after a walk to Lowther Castle with my son. My phone battery was dead and I was tired so we decided to stay overnight. The manager, I believe his name was Nico, offered to call me a cab back to Penrith even before I was a guest. When we decided to stay he was so hospitable and made me feel welcome. He told me that I missed dinner but that he could bring us a snack, and I ordered a plate of charcutterie and Nico and another staff member brought it up to my room and endearingly remained polite while they assembled an awkward travel cot for my son. It was a wonderful escape from daily life and this hotel in a little village by the river felt like a fairy tale. We will definitely be coming back but more prepared and ready for dinner. I was also really pleased to see that in the larder they had wine from a vineyard I toured in Chile. I would have given this hotel five stars had it not been for the morning staff. The woman hosting breakfast made me feel self conscious about having a noisy child and reminded me that they had other guests, and when I asked the woman at the desk to call me a cab in the morning she told me I had to call them myself, gave me the landline phone and let me struggle with the chord and dial the number while I had the strap of my son's harness in the other hand. Then she stepped out behind my desk, over my son, and left me to it. Other than that it was a fabulous experience. Looking forward to returning.
